利用美國伺服器搭建海外遊戲加速節點的方法

使用美國伺服器租用服務建構遊戲加速節點是遊戲玩家解決延遲問題的前沿解決方案。雖然商業遊戲加速器主導著市場,但越來越多具有技術素養的使用者選擇使用美國伺服器來打造客製化解決方案。本綜合指南深入探討了建立自己的加速基礎設施的技術細節,重點關注效能最佳化和網路效率。
伺服器選擇指南
選擇合適的美國伺服器是搭建遊戲加速設施的基礎。所需的技術規格根據並行使用者數量和目標遊戲而變化。為獲得最佳效能,建議考慮以下規格的伺服器:
– CPU:最低8核處理器(AMD EPYC或Intel Xeon)
– 記憶體:最低16GB DDR4,建議重負載使用32GB
– 儲存:至少256GB容量的NVMe固態硬碟
– 網路:不限流量且連接埠速度為1Gbps
– DDoS防護:最低10Gbps防護能力
技術前提條件
在開始設定過程之前,請確保您具備紮實的技術基礎。基本前提條件包括:
– 美國伺服器的root存取憑證
– Linux命令列操作的實務知識
– TCP/IP網路基礎知識
– 熟悉iptables和路由協定
– 基本指令碼編寫能力(Bash/Python)
– SSL/TLS憑證管理經驗
此外,在設定過程中要保持對伺服器配置和任何修改的詳細文件記錄。這在故障排除或擴展操作時將變得非常有價值。
安裝和配置
安裝過程遵循系統化方法,從全新的Ubuntu 22.04 LTS安裝開始。以下是詳細步驟:
1. 系統準備:
– 更新軟體套件儲存庫
– 安裝基本安全軟體套件
– 配置SSH加固
– 設定fail2ban防暴力破解
2. 網路協定棧配置:
– 根據需要啟用IPv6支援
– 配置網路介面
– 最佳化sysctl參數
– 設定流量整形規則
3. 加速軟體部署:
– 安裝所需相依套件
– 配置核心模組
– 設定加速守護程序
– 初始化連線處理
4. 路由配置:
– 建立最佳路由
– 根據需要配置BGP
– 設定NAT規則
– 實現流量分流
在進行下一步之前請驗證每個步驟,以確保系統穩定性和最佳效能。
網路最佳化
網路最佳化是加速設定的核心。實施以下關鍵調整:
TCP協定棧最佳化:
– 啟用BBR擁塞控制:sysctl net.core.default_qdisc=fq
– 增加TCP緩衝區大小
– 調整TCP keepalive參數
– 最佳化TCP視窗縮放
QoS實施:
– 配置流量分類
– 設定優先順序佇列
– 實現頻寬分配
– 配置流量整形規則
MTU最佳化:
– 確定最佳MTU大小
– 配置MSS鉗制
– 設定PMTUD
– 監控分片問題
每項最佳化都應單獨測試以衡量其對整體效能的影響。
進階配置
實施進階功能可顯著提高加速基礎設施的可靠性和效能:
多節點架構:
– 部署地理分散式節點
– 實施節點健康檢查
– 配置自動節點選擇
– 設定節點間通訊協定
負載平衡:
– 部署HAProxy或NGINX進行負載分配
– 配置會話持久性
– 實施健康檢查
– 設定故障轉移機制
即時監控:
– 部署Prometheus收集指標
– 配置Grafana儀表板
– 設定警報系統
– 實施日誌聚合
這些進階配置在正式部署前需要在測試環境中進行仔細測試。
安全實施
健全的安全框架對保護加速基礎設施至關重要:
防火牆配置:
– 配置iptables規則
– 實施連線速率限制
– 設定連接埠敲門
– 啟用狀態追蹤
DDoS防護:
– 部署TCP SYN cookies
– 配置連線限制
– 實施黑洞路由
– 設定流量分析工具
存取控制:
– 實施基於角色的存取控制
– 配置SSH金鑰認證
– 設定IP白名單
– 在適用處部署雙因素認證
應定期進行安全稽核以識別和解決潛在漏洞。維護安全事件回應計畫。
效能測試
全面測試確保最佳效能:
網路分析:
– 使用MTR進行路由追蹤
– 部署smokeping監控延遲
– 實施定期速度測試
– 監控封包遺失率
頻寬測試:
– 使用iperf3測量吞吐量
– 測試尖峰時段效能
– 監控頻寬使用率
– 分析流量模式
客製化測試工具:
– 開發自動化測試指令碼
– 實施持續監控
– 設定效能基準
– 建立測試文件
記錄所有測試結果並維護歷史效能資料以進行趨勢分析。
維護程序
建立定期維護計畫:
每週任務:
– 系統更新和修補程式
– 日誌輪替和分析
– 效能指標審查
– 執行安全掃描
每月任務:
– 完整系統備份
– 配置審查
– 資源使用分析
– 容量規劃更新
應急程序:
– 定義事件回應協定
– 維護備份系統
– 文件復原程序
– 測試災難復原計畫
儘可能自動化維護任務以確保一致性並減少人為錯誤。
故障排除指南
系統地解決常見問題:
延遲問題:
– 檢查網路路由
– 分析伺服器負載
– 審查防火牆規則
– 監控系統資源
頻寬問題:
– 驗證服務商限制
– 檢查DDoS攻擊
– 分析流量模式
– 審查QoS設定
連線失敗:
– 驗證DNS解析
– 檢查SSL憑證
– 審查認證日誌
– 監控服務狀態
記錄所有故障排除步驟和解決方案以供將來參考。
透過美國伺服器租用服務建立遊戲加速節點需要技術專業知識和細緻入微的注意力。本指南為建構和維護加速基礎設施提供了基礎。定期更新、監控和最佳化確保您的設定在遊戲加速領域保持有效和具有競爭力。